在这里学什么?Scientific and technological advances provide the basis of international competitiveness and account for the bulk of national growth and the improvement of the quality of life around the world. The ability to create, adapt, and adopt new technologies defines modern societies. In today's global environment, the need for innovation is essential for solving societal problems and staying ahead of competition. Developments in information technology, space exploration, genetic modification, and advances in material science are governed and shaped by institutions that set science and technology policy. The Master of Arts in International Science and Technology Policy prepares students to understand and respond to these important dynamics.
The multidisciplinary 40-credit M.A. program in International Science and Technology Policy includes a core field in science technology and international affairs, which allows students to concentrate on areas of particular interest; an analytical competency requirement, which provides career-enhancing, marketable skills in policy analysis, economic theory, or statistics; and an elective field which reflects individual interests and career goals.
Recent graduates often work in research, analysis, or management positions with titles such as research analyst, program or policy analyst, legislative analyst, or more specialized areas. Analysts are often employed with government agencies, advocacy groups, think tanks, science and technology-oriented publications, and other organizations.

为来自中国的学生设计 To be eligible for admission, applicants must hold a Bachelor's degree from a regionally accredited college or university. Applicants who have earned their degrees outside of the US must hold degrees from institutions in compliance with their national standards. Academic IELTS: an overall band score of 6.0 with no individual score below 5.0; or TOEFL: 550 on paper-based or 80 on Internet-based test; or PTE Academic: 53.课程信息
